Problem

Existing advertising technologies fail to provide highly targeted and personalized advertisements that account for user interactions across multiple devices, content consumption, and behavioral data, leading to ineffective ad delivery and user engagement.

Innovation Solution

A voice-controlled device and remote computing resources work together to select and provide targeted advertisements based on user interactions, content consumption, behavioral data, geo-location, and demographic information, using speech recognition and natural language understanding to generate and deliver personalized audio, video, or interactive ads.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ent segments advertising delivery into multiple specialized modules: speech recognition module for voice input processing, natural language understanding module for intent extraction, user profile module for behavioral data storage, and ad selection module for personalized ad delivery. Each module handles a specific aspect of the advertising process, improving targeting precision while managing system complexity through functional decomposition.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ent introduces a natural language understanding module as an intermediary between speech recognition and ad selection. This mediator translates raw speech data into structured user intent and preferences, which then guide the ad selection process. By inserting this intermediary layer, the system can handle multiple data sources (speech inputs, behavioral data, contextual information) without requiring complex direct integration between all components.

Solution Approach 2:

The system performs preliminary actions by continuously building and updating user profiles based on observed behavioral data before ad delivery occurs. User preferences, viewing habits, and contextual information are pre-processed and stored in the user profile module, so when ad selection is needed, the system can quickly retrieve relevant pre-analyzed data rather than processing raw data in real-time, reducing processing complexity.

AI summary

Techniques for selecting and providing highly targeted, interactive advertisements in a personalized manner. These advertisements may be audio-only advertisements, video-only advertisements, or advertisements that include both audio and video. As described below, advertisements may be selected and/or generated for a particular user based on an array of factors, including the user's interactions with multiple different client devices (e.g., a tablet computing device, a voice-controlled device, a television etc.), as well as additional behavior of the user. In some instances, the client devices may include a voice-controlled device that the user interacts with via voice commands and that provides audible content for output to the user.
